Hersonissos is a popular tourist destination located on the island of Crete in Greece. The town is situated on the northeast coast of the island and is known for its lively atmosphere, beautiful beaches, and crystal-clear waters.
Visitors to Hersonissos can spend their days lounging on the sandy beaches, swimming in the turquoise waters, and enjoying water sports such as snorkeling, diving, and windsurfing. For those interested in history, the nearby ruins of the Minoan palace of Malia offer a glimpse into the ancient civilization that once inhabited Crete.
In the evening, Hersonissos comes alive with a variety of bars, clubs, and tavernas offering live music, dancing, and delicious local cuisine. The town is also known for its lively nightlife, making it a popular destination for young travelers.

In Hersonissos, Crete, younger people can enjoy vibrant nightlife with numerous bars and clubs, such as Star Beach and the New York Beach Club. Adventure enthusiasts can partake in water sports like jet skiing, parasailing, and snorkeling at the beach. The area’s beautiful sandy shores are great for sunbathing and beach volleyball. Additionally, visitors can explore local shops, dine at trendy restaurants, or take part in beach parties. For those seeking culture, nearby attractions include the Lychnostatis Open Air Museum and the ancient ruins of Malia.
In Hersonissos, Crete, families with children can enjoy a variety of activities including visiting the Aquaworld Aquarium and Reptile Rescue Centre for an interactive experience with marine life and reptiles, spending a day at the nearby Star Beach Water Park featuring pools and slides, and exploring the local beaches, such as Stalis Beach, which offers shallow waters perfect for children. Additionally, families might enjoy taking a boat trip to nearby secluded coves or enjoying local amenities like playgrounds and family-friendly restaurants that cater to kids.
Hersonissos, Crete offers a romantic escape for couples with its stunning beaches, vibrant nightlife, and charming dining options. You can stroll along the scenic harbor, indulge in a candlelit dinner at a seaside taverna, or relax on the serene beaches like Stalida or Anissaras. For adventure, consider a couples’ day trip to nearby attractions such as the ancient ruins of Knossos or the picturesque village of Archanes. Don’t miss the chance to unwind at a local spa or take a sunset cruise for an unforgettable romantic experience.
